Why
“Primetime”?
- The name
identifies a point in time of great significance and
importance. The Junior High teens are at such a time, socially,
physically, emotionally, and spiritually.
- The name
communicates the excitement, importance, and time of day for
“Primetime” weekly meetings. (Wednesdays 6:30-8:00 PM)

We know
that the primary influence in the life of a teenager is still mom
and dad. You are the real spiritual leaders of your teen. Youth
ministry is most effective when parents and a strong Youth Ministry
are working together.
It is
our desire to come beside you as a parent and work together that our
teens may truly grow in Jesus Christ and learn to serve Him!
